Brazilian Ginseng

Brazilian Ginseng

Latin name: Pfaffia paniculata

Common names: Brazilian ginseng, Suma root, Paratudo (“for everything”)

Traditional wisdom

Known as paratudo — “for everything” — Brazilian ginseng has long been used in South American herbal traditions as a revitalizing tonic. It is believed to enhance resilience, sharpen clarity, and restore energy when the mind feels slow or foggy. A supportive herb for strengthening both body and focus.

Safety & precautions

  • Generally well tolerated as a tonic herb.
  • May mildly increase energy; avoid close to bedtime if sensitive.
  • Consult your healthcare provider if you have hypertension or are taking stimulants.
  • Not recommended during pregnancy without professional supervision.
